25 /* the debug operations structure - contains function pointers to
26 various debug implementations of each operation */
27 struct debug_ops {
28 /* function to log (using DEBUG) suspicious usage of data structure */
29 void (*log_suspicious_usage)(const char* from, const char* info);
31 /* function to log (using printf) suspicious usage of data structure.
32 * To be used in circumstances when using DEBUG would cause loop. */
33 void (*print_suspicious_usage)(const char* from, const char* info);
35 /* function to return process/thread id */
36 uint32_t (*get_task_id)(void);
38 /* function to log process/thread id */
39 void (*log_task_id)(int fd);
42 extern int DEBUGLEVEL;
44 #define debug_ctx() (_debug_ctx?_debug_ctx:(_debug_ctx=talloc_new(NULL)))
46 #define DEBUGLVL(level) ((level) <= DEBUGLEVEL)
47 #define _DEBUG(level, body, header) do { \
48 if (DEBUGLVL(level)) { \
49 void* _debug_ctx=NULL; \
50 if (header) { \
51 do_debug_header(level, __location__, __FUNCTION__); \
52 } \
53 do_debug body; \
54 talloc_free(_debug_ctx); \
55 } \
56 } while (0)
57 /**
58 * Write to the debug log.
60 #define DEBUG(level, body) _DEBUG(level, body, true)
61 /**
62 * Add data to an existing debug log entry.
64 #define DEBUGADD(level, body) _DEBUG(level, body, false)
66 /**
67 * Obtain indentation string for the debug log.
69 * Level specified by n.
71 #define DEBUGTAB(n) do_debug_tab(n)
73 /** Possible destinations for the debug log */
74 enum debug_logtype {DEBUG_STDOUT = 0, DEBUG_FILE = 1, DEBUG_STDERR = 2};
